Just returned from London (England, not Ontario.... I know some of you were going to ask) - which appears to the place of no Camaros. Even the posh dealer on Park Lane which has Cadillacs and Hummers in the window next to Bentleys, Aston Martins and Lambos didn't have any. (There is a right-hand drive version produced isn't there?) I asked if they had any brochure (nice addition to the collection) but they had none.
Anyway... back to my point. While I was over there walking around I came up with a few ideas Camaro related. I'll start separate threads if interest shows. - GTA Camaro friends Holiday GTG / poker night: This one's meant to be local. We have said we'll still have tom casual GTGs over the winter. I was thinking of hosting a holiday social or even poker night sometime between Christmas and New Years. No poker pros please . I have all the supplies and would love to host (I'm west-edge Mississauga). Interested?- Camaro Summer Calendar: This past year was a ton of fun. Meets, shows, GTG's etc. Seemed non-stop at times but always left my hungry for more. Call me type-A or organization-freak but I was thinking that a local calendar would be good to put all the big events (Camaro Nationals, St. Cath's weekend, 2010 Buyer & Builder event) and all the local weekly events on it (Maple Cruisers etc). If everyone can see the events they can plan in advance to attend = more attendance. Of course this would have to be region specific. GTA/Ontario is big so maybe a good place to start - others to follow? - Track Time!!!: OK - there was lots of talk about this. I think some here even said they took their Camaro's to Mosport. But the larger populous that talked about getting a group together to do this never got the idea off the ground. I really (really) want to do this. Never done it before and I know the big track at Mosport is challenging. So I'm thinking that I'd like to have a group of 10-15 of us coordinate a day with one of the driving schools at Mosport on the Driver-Development-Track (DDT). Someone here posted a link to one such company - I checked it out - looked good. Safe, non-competitive, controlled passing, lots of track time, go fast LEGALLY!!! Let's do it. Let's start organizing it in January. March will already be too late! Interest please! - Summer driving trip: This past year there were a few times where Hylton, Rick, Rick, Gary and many others (too many to list) came in from out of town to attend an event. Being local to these larger events I (and others) never got to experience the long-distance Camaro road-trip joy. I was contemplating a multi-day tour this summer. Maybe 5-8 days. Maybe to the east coast? PEI? Always wanted to drive Manitoulin Island & across the top of Superior. Anyone interested?
